HP t820: Disassembly 

Disassembly

HP t820 top panel removal
Disassembly is straightforward. The starting point is to undo the large knob at the top of the rear panel. Having done that you can slide the top panel a short distance to the rear, lift it off and put it to one side.

HP t820 inside
Looking inside you can see metalwork for fitting a 2.5" hard drive and a DVD drive. This obscures the motherboard and the mSATA flash drive.

HP t820 sata drive metalwork
Looking at the metalwork you can see that it breaks down into two pieces. The basic framework for a 5.25" DVD drive (or similar) and a carrier for a 2.5" hard drive.

HP t820 sata drive metalwork removal
Pulling the catch at the rear of the carrier towards the front of the t820 lets you lift it out of the chassis.

HP t820 sata drive metalwork out
The carrier intended for a 2.5" hard drive removed from the t820.

HP t820 DVD carrier mountings
This just leaves the metalwork support intended to hold a DVD drive or similar. This is secured by two screws (circled) and a latch (arrowed).

Remove the two screws.

HP t820 DVD carrier latch
More detail of the latch that has to be lifted before the DVD mounting metalwork can be slid to the rear and removed.

HP t820 DVD carrier out of the chassis
The carrier intended for a DVD drive out of the chassis.

HP t820 motherboard
The motherboard with all the metalwork out of the way.
